Output 2bb9f1bb507923c249fa9f645f2c50fc1f42e2ec96ea5836daf09f9a2af0cfb0:0

value
28044617
script pubkey
OP_0 OP_PUSHBYTES_20 8d59b9139843c613b75d264decee4c506e7a3417
address
bc1q34vmjyucg0rp8d6ayex7emjv2ph85dqhq8k38a
transaction
2bb9f1bb507923c249fa9f645f2c50fc1f42e2ec96ea5836daf09f9a2af0cfb0
confirmations
31186
spent
true